🚀 About Exchange Program:

The Community College Initiative Program (CCI) is a flagship initiative of the Bureau of Educational and Cultural Affairs (ECA), aimed at providing individuals from diverse backgrounds with the opportunity to study at community colleges in the United States. Through CCI, participants not only enhance their academic and technical skills but also immerse themselves in American culture and society. By fostering meaningful connections and promoting dialogue, CCI contributes to building bridges between nations and cultivating a global community of engaged citizens.

🎓 Eligibility Criteria:

  • Minimum age of 18 years
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Basic knowledge of English
  • Demonstrated commitment to personal and professional growth
  • Ability to fulfill program requirements and start the program in the United States by July 2023
  • Meet country-specific eligibility requirements determined by the Fulbright Commission or the Public Affairs Section of the U.S. Embassy
